“The Imperial Challenge” Bike/Ascent/Descent Race
Saturday, April 14th at 10:00 am
This year marks the 21st annual Imperial Challenge! This warms up with a 6.2 mile mountain bike ride from the Town of Breckenridge across Peak 7 to Peak 8, followed by a 2,500 foot ascent of Peak 8 to the top of the Imperial Bowl on the equipment of your choice. As your quadriceps quiver from oxygen deprivation and lactic acid build up, begin your descent to the base of Peak 8 on skis or a snowboard. An hour and forty-five minutes could win; two hours would be a great time! Visit www.mavsports.com for details & to register.

  • GREAT PERFORMANCE!! DON'T MISS THIS WEEKS!!Toots and the Maytals – Toots & The Maytals are one of the most well-known ska and reggae acts in history. Considered legends in their genre, their Jamaican sound is a unique, original combination of gospel, ska, soul, reggae and rock. Join us at the base of Peak 8 for the unique sounds of Toots & the Maytals! Toots & The Maytals are one of the world’s most legendary ska & reggae groups. Credited with being the first band to ever use the term “reggae” in a song, their musical combination that also includes gospel, soul and rock is a perfect blend for a high-energy live performance on the specially-constructed BudLight stage!
